Match details

  • Match: Northern Superchargers Women vs Welsh Fire Women
  • Venue: Headingley, Leeds
  • Toss: Northern Superchargers Women won the toss and opted to bat

The Northern Superchargers Women comfortably extended their strong start to the tournament, winning Match 3 against the Welsh Fire Women by a convincing 47 runs at Headingley, Leeds. Choosing to bat, the Superchargers batted well for a total of 141 for 4, thanks to Phoebe Litchfield's 43 off 30, Armitage's 34* innings, and some good late-order hitting from Georgian Wareham (29*). Welsh Fire capitulated their effort to just 94 all out with only Tammy Beaumont (36 off 21) offering any resistance as Supercharger's bowlers Wareham, Linsey Smith, and Grace Ballinger were too tight and incisive in their spells of bowling to offer any chance of victory.
